暗号資産(仮想通貨)のスマートウォレット設定方法を解説
暗号資産(仮想通貨)の利用が拡大するにつれて、その保管方法の重要性が増しています。従来のウォレットに代わり、近年注目を集めているのが「スマートウォレット」です。スマートウォレットは、セキュリティと利便性を両立し、より安全かつ効率的な暗号資産管理を可能にします。本稿では、スマートウォレットの仕組みから設定方法、利用上の注意点まで、詳細に解説します。
スマートウォレットとは?
スマートウォレットは、従来のウォレットとは異なり、単なる暗号資産の保管場所ではありません。スマートコントラクトを活用し、自動化されたセキュリティ機能や高度な管理機能を提供します。具体的には、以下のような特徴があります。
- 多要素認証(MFA):パスワードに加えて、生体認証やワンタイムパスワードなどを組み合わせることで、不正アクセスを防止します。
- トランザクションの承認ルール:特定の条件を満たした場合にのみトランザクションを承認するように設定できます。例えば、「1日あたりの送金上限額」や「特定の送金先への送金制限」などを設定できます。
- 自動的な鍵の管理:秘密鍵を安全に保管し、自動的に管理します。ユーザー自身が秘密鍵を管理する必要がないため、紛失や盗難のリスクを軽減できます。
- アカウント抽象化(Account Abstraction):スマートコントラクトによってアカウントのロジックを定義し、柔軟なカスタマイズを可能にします。
これらの特徴により、スマートウォレットは、従来のウォレットよりも高いセキュリティと利便性を実現しています。
スマートウォレットの種類
スマートウォレットには、様々な種類が存在します。主な種類としては、以下のようなものが挙げられます。
- カストディアルウォレット:第三者が秘密鍵を管理するウォレットです。取引所などが提供しているウォレットが該当します。利便性が高い反面、第三者のセキュリティリスクに依存するため、注意が必要です。
- ノンカストディアルウォレット:ユーザー自身が秘密鍵を管理するウォレットです。MetaMaskやTrust Walletなどが該当します。セキュリティは高いですが、秘密鍵の管理に責任を持つ必要があります。
- マルチシグウォレット:複数の承認が必要となるウォレットです。複数の関係者で共同で暗号資産を管理する場合に利用されます。セキュリティは非常に高いですが、設定が複雑になる場合があります。
- ハードウェアウォレット:物理的なデバイスに秘密鍵を保管するウォレットです。LedgerやTrezorなどが該当します。オフラインで保管するため、セキュリティは非常に高いですが、デバイスの紛失や破損に注意が必要です。
それぞれのウォレットには、メリットとデメリットがあるため、自身の利用目的やリスク許容度に合わせて選択することが重要です。
スマートウォレットの設定方法
ここでは、代表的なノンカストディアルウォレットであるMetaMaskを例に、スマートウォレットの設定方法を解説します。
MetaMaskのインストール
- MetaMaskの公式サイト(https://metamask.io/)にアクセスします。
- ブラウザに合わせたMetaMaskの拡張機能をダウンロードし、インストールします。
- MetaMaskのアイコンをクリックし、利用規約に同意します。
ウォレットの作成
- 「ウォレットを作成」を選択します。
- 秘密鍵のバックアップを促されます。必ず12個のリカバリーフレーズを安全な場所に記録してください。このフレーズは、ウォレットを復元するために必要不可欠です。
- リカバリーフレーズを正しく入力し、確認します。
- パスワードを設定します。パスワードは、ウォレットへのアクセスに使用されます。
ネットワークの設定
- MetaMaskのデフォルトのネットワークはEthereumメインネットです。他のネットワーク(Binance Smart Chain、Polygonなど)を利用する場合は、ネットワーク設定を変更する必要があります。
- 「ネットワークを選択」をクリックし、「ネットワークを追加」を選択します。
- 必要な情報を入力し、新しいネットワークを追加します。
スマートコントラクトとの連携
スマートウォレットの機能を最大限に活用するには、スマートコントラクトとの連携が必要です。例えば、DeFi(分散型金融)サービスを利用する場合、スマートコントラクトとMetaMaskを連携させることで、自動的な利息計算や流動性提供などの機能を利用できます。
スマートコントラクトとの連携方法は、サービスによって異なります。一般的には、MetaMaskのポップアップウィンドウでトランザクションを承認することで連携が完了します。
スマートウォレット利用上の注意点
スマートウォレットは、従来のウォレットよりも安全性が高いですが、それでも注意すべき点がいくつかあります。
- フィッシング詐欺:偽のウェブサイトやメールに誘導し、秘密鍵やリカバリーフレーズを盗み取ろうとする詐欺です。不審なリンクやメールには注意し、公式サイトからアクセスするように心がけてください。
- マルウェア感染:パソコンやスマートフォンがマルウェアに感染し、秘密鍵が盗み取られる可能性があります。セキュリティソフトを導入し、常に最新の状態に保つようにしてください。
- スマートコントラクトのリスク:スマートコントラクトに脆弱性がある場合、資金が盗まれる可能性があります。信頼できるスマートコントラクトのみを利用するようにしてください。
- 秘密鍵の管理:ノンカストディアルウォレットの場合、秘密鍵の管理はユーザー自身が行う必要があります。秘密鍵を紛失したり、盗まれたりすると、資金を失う可能性があります。
これらの注意点を守り、安全にスマートウォレットを利用するように心がけてください。
スマートウォレットの将来展望
スマートウォレットは、暗号資産の普及を促進する上で重要な役割を果たすと考えられています。アカウント抽象化の技術が進歩することで、より柔軟で使いやすいスマートウォレットが登場することが期待されます。また、DeFiやNFT(非代替性トークン)などの分野との連携も進み、スマートウォレットの利用シーンはますます拡大していくでしょう。
さらに、スマートウォレットは、Web3(分散型ウェブ)の基盤技術としても注目されています。Web3の世界では、ユーザーが自身のデータを完全にコントロールできるようになりますが、そのための鍵となるのがスマートウォレットです。スマートウォレットの普及は、Web3の実現を加速させるでしょう。
まとめ
スマートウォレットは、セキュリティと利便性を両立した次世代の暗号資産管理ツールです。本稿では、スマートウォレットの仕組みから設定方法、利用上の注意点まで、詳細に解説しました。スマートウォレットを適切に設定し、安全に利用することで、暗号資産の可能性を最大限に引き出すことができるでしょう。暗号資産の利用を検討している方は、ぜひスマートウォレットの導入を検討してみてください。